Shah Alloys Ltd Downgraded to Strong Sell Amid Technical and Fundamental Weaknesses
Shah Alloys Ltd, a micro-cap player in the Iron & Steel Products sector, has been downgraded from a Sell to a Strong Sell rating as of 8 May 2026. This revision reflects deteriorating technical indicators, weak financial trends, poor valuation metrics, and declining quality scores, signalling heightened risk for investors despite the stock’s recent market-beating returns.

Shah Alloys Ltd Upgraded to Sell on Technical Improvements Despite Weak Fundamentals
Shah Alloys Ltd, a micro-cap player in the Iron & Steel Products sector, has seen its investment rating upgraded from Strong Sell to Sell as of 28 Apr 2026. This change is primarily driven by a shift in technical indicators signalling mild bullishness, despite persistent fundamental weaknesses and valuation concerns. The company’s stock performance continues to outpace the broader market, but caution remains warranted given its negative book value and flat financial trends.
